System and method for finding desired results by incremental search using an ambiguous keypad with the input containing orthographic and typographic errors

Abstract

A system for finding and presenting content items in response to keystrokes entered by a user on an input device having a known layout of overloaded keys selected from a set of key layouts. The system includes (1) a database containing content items and terms characterizing the content items; (2) input logic for receiving keystrokes from the user and building a string corresponding to incremental entries by the user, each item in the string having the set of alphanumeric symbols associated with a corresponding keystroke; (3) mapping logic to map the string to the database to find the most likely content items corresponding to the incremental entries, the mapping logic operating in accordance with a defined error model corresponding to the known layout of overloaded keys; and (4) presentation logic for ordering the most likely content items identified by the mapping logic and for presenting the most likely content items.

Claims (30)

1. A computer-implemented user-interface system for incrementally finding and presenting one or more content items in response to keystrokes entered by a user on an input device having a known layout of overloaded keys selected from a set of key layouts, each overloaded key having a corresponding set of alphanumeric symbols, the system comprising:

a database stored in a computer memory, the database containing content items and corresponding descriptive terms that characterize the content items;

a computer memory comprising instructions for causing a computer system to:

receive keystrokes from the user and build a string corresponding to incremental entries by the user, each item in the string having the set of alphanumeric symbols associated with a corresponding keystroke;

map the string to the database to find the most likely content items corresponding to the incremental entries, the mapping being in accordance with a defined error model, the error model corresponding to the known layout of overloaded keys of the input device;

wherein the error model associates the string with:

(i) suggested corrections for typographic errors corresponding to incremental user entries, wherein suggested corrections are derived by replacing characters in the string resulting from one or more accidently pressed adjacent keys;

(ii) suggested corrections for orthographic errors corresponding to incremental user entries, wherein suggested corrections are derived by replacing one or more characters in the string resulting from phonetic substitutions; and

wherein the most likely content items are ordered and presented on a display device in accordance with defined ordering criteria;

such that the user-interface system receives ambiguous entries from the user and presents the most likely matching content items.

2. The system of claim 1 , wherein the error model includes generating typographic variants of the descriptive terms that characterize the content items.

3. The system of claim 1 , wherein the error model includes generating orthographic variants of the descriptive terms that characterize the content items.

4. The system of claim 1 , wherein the error model includes generating variants based on at least one of inserting, deleting, substituting, and transposing one or more characters of the descriptive terms that characterize the content items.

5. The system of claim 1 , wherein the error model includes generating N-gram variants of the descriptive terms that characterize the content items, the N-gram variants including variants based on nonadjacent characters of the descriptive terms.

6. The system of claim 1 , wherein the error model includes distance functions to assign error penalties to errors occurring in the string.

7. The system of claim 1 , wherein the database contains pre-computed variants of the descriptive terms that characterize the content items and the mapping logic maps the incremental entries to the pre-computed variants.

8. The system of claim 7 , wherein the pre-computed variants are encoded according to the known layout of overloaded keys of the input device.

9. The system of claim 1 , wherein mapping the string to the database generates variants based on the incremental entries and uses the variants to find the most likely content items corresponding to the incremental entries.

10. The system of claim 1 , wherein the instructions for mapping the string to the database further cause the computer system to:

identify a first set of content items corresponding to a first set of alphanumeric symbols in the string;

identify a second set of content items corresponding to a second set of alphanumeric symbols in the string; and

include content items appearing in both the first and second set of content items in the most likely content items corresponding to the incremental entries.

11. The system of claim 10 , wherein the identifying the first set of content items, identifying the second set of content items, and including the content items appearing in both the first and second set of content items in the most likely content items is invoked when the number of most likely content items returned by mapping the string to the database to find the most likely content items corresponding to the incremental entries alone is below a predetermined threshold.

12. The system of claim 1 , wherein the defined ordering criteria includes at least one of personalized user preferences, popularity of the content items, temporal relevance of the content items, location relevance of the content items, recency of the content items, and relevance of the descriptive terms to the content items.

13. The system of claim 1 , wherein the string is mapped to the database according to a trie descend.

14. The system of claim 1 , wherein the input device is an input constrained device.

15. The system of claim 1 , wherein the input device is a wireless communication device, a mobile phone, a PDA, a personal media player, or a television remote control.

16. The system of claim 1 , wherein the display device is a display constrained device.

17. The system of claim 1 , wherein the display device is a wireless communication device, a mobile phone, a PDA, a personal media player, or a television.

18. The system of claim 1 , wherein the input device and the display device are the same device.
